    Job Summary

    To manage operations for an urgent care clinic. Manage all non-physician clinic staff. Ensure quality of patient care. Ensure maintenance of the clinic building and supplies. Ensure complete and accurate charges are attributed to each patient.

    Responsibilities (included, but not limited to):

    Lead by example while fostering team spirit, professionalism, and operational excellence.

    Deliver exceptional patient care experiences, as measured by positive feedback and reviews.

    Optimize workflow and identify opportunities to improve operating efficiencies.

    Train and develop staff utilizing the established training and development programs.

    Ensure all staff maintain current licensures, certifications, and required credentials.

    Conduct performance reviews and partner with HR to address disciplinary actions when necessary.

    Maintain the staff schedule while managing time-off requests to prevent shortages or unplanned closures.

    Serve as backup for front office or clinical support staff during breaks or absences, as needed.

    Review and approve timecards, ensuring accurate reporting and minimizing overtime.

    Enforce and support all company-wide policies, procedures, and protocols.

    Ensure the facility is secure, compliant, clean, well-maintained, and free of hazards.

    Confirm all medical and office equipment is functional, maintained, and calibrated as required.

    Maintain inventory levels within budget while ensuring the center remains fully supplied for daily operations.

    Investigate and assist in resolving patient grievances or service concerns.

    Conduct regular chart reviews to ensure accuracy and completeness of documentation and charges.

    Ensure audits are performed timely and that all findings are reviewed and addressed.
